About the Red Index in LED Lighting15-05-2025
The Color Rendering Index (CRI) is a scale from 0 to 100 that measures how accurately a light source renders colors compared to natural daylight. While CRI provides a general assessment, it doesn't fully capture the accuracy of rendering certain colors, particularly saturated reds. This is where R9 comes into play.
 
R9 is a specific component of the CRI system that measures how well a light source renders saturated red colors. It is part of the extended CRI scale, which includes values R1 to R15, each representing the rendering ability of a particular color sample. R9 corresponds to the test color sample TCS09, which is a strong red hue. Unlike the general CRI, which averages the scores of R1 to R8, R9 is not included in the CRI calculation but is crucial for applications requiring accurate red color reproduction.


High R9 values indicate that a light source can accurately reproduce vibrant red colors, which is essential in various settings:
 
Healthcare: Accurate red rendering is vital for assessing skin tones and blood flow.
Retail: Enhances the appearance of red products, making them more appealing to customers.
Art and Photography: Ensures that artworks and photographs are displayed with true-to-life colors.
Food Industry: Improves the visual appeal of red foods, influencing consumer perception.
 
In these applications, a high R9 value is often more critical than a high general CRI, as it directly impacts the accuracy of red color reproduction. The significance of R9 values varies depending on the application. In residential lighting an R9 value of 25 is generally considered acceptable. In retail and art displays, an R9 value above 75 is often required to ensure vibrant and accurate red colors. Within the area of healthcare and photography ann R9 value close to 100 is ideal for precise color rendering.
 
To achieve high R9 values, manufacturers can use phosphor-conversion techniques and advanced LED chip technologies. Selecting LEDs with high R9 values ensures that red colors are rendered accurately, enhancing the overall color quality of the lighting.
 
When selecting LED lighting for applications where accurate red color rendering is essential, it has to be ensured that the LED product specifies its R9 value. By considering R9 values alongside general CRI, it is possible to select LED lighting that meets the specific color rendering requirements of lighting applications.
